REVIEW
This thought-provoking sexual odyssey tells the story of a young West German woman and her search for "romantic love." Frustrated by the emptiness and the emotional morass of her native Hamburg, Dorothee decides to flee her home to search for her mother, who is living in San Francisco. Once arrived, however, her trek turns into a process of sexual discovery. Filmed in a steamy black and white, the film exudes a sensuality in which simple lust is transformed into glorious eroticism. While The Virgin Machine is clearly a feminist film about a woman's exploration of her own sexuality, its profound statement is one which applies to all. (English and German with English subtitles)
